Internet development is actually a wide-ranging job that involves every little thing from profit as well as coding to scripting as well as network setup. It’s also a developing area that’s optimal for individuals with an enthusiasm for technology as well as a determination to know.
If you utilize a site, a smartphone, an electronic cam or any type of other internet-enabled unit, HTML is actually the shows language that makes it possible. Web growth is a pc programs self-control that is actually focused on structure online requests. In enhancement to its own capability to feature web content, HTML additionally has semantic aspects that can help strengthen readability, availability (display screen audiences utilize these tags), as well as Search engine optimisation placing.
Internet development is a computer shows willpower that focuses on structure online applications. Opportunities are that web developers have been working on it if you have actually ever gone to a web site that performs and also looks as it should. Go through on to know additional regarding the skills you need to obtain begun if you are actually curious in becoming a web creator.
CSS (Cascading Style Sheets) is a rule-based foreign language that explains the look of a website page. It could be used for every thing from extremely simple file content styling to defining whole styles. It becomes part of every web page online as well as can be a highly effective device in any type of web professional’s collection.
It is one of one of the most prominent foreign languages for coding internet uses. It is actually used through major modern technology companies like Google, Facebook, as well as Amazon.com to generate interactive websites as well as apps. It is actually a scripting language that is actually quick and easy to learn as well as can be included right into existing HTML code.
It is actually utilized in numerous of the well-liked internet internet browsers, as well as it can likewise be utilized to produce standalone treatments for several working bodies. It may be actually made use of to run a tcp hosting server and also plan outlets along with “web,” as properly as read/write data along with “fs” and compose streaming-ready web servers with “http”.
Node is asynchronous in attributes as well as occasion driven, which makes it a great choice for real time internet requests that require fast records streaming. It is actually also easy to scalability, which is a vital facet of software program development. This is actually because it makes use of child processes to deal with simultaneous asks for.
Express is actually an open-source framework for writing internet requests in Node. It gives approaches to manage HTTP verbs (GET, ARTICLE, etc), link trends (” courses”), as well as theme engines (” viewpoint”). It is likewise unopinionated concerning just how a request needs to be structured. This allows creators to pick from a wide range of middleware packages.
GitHub is actually a well-known program growth source as well as is actually utilized by thousands of programmers. GitHub was actually started in April 2008 by Tom Preston-Werner, Chris Wanstrath and PJ Hyett, who cultivated a web user interface for it making use of Ruby on Bed rails and Erlang.
Finding out just how to utilize GitHub can easily assist you remain ahead of the competitors if you are actually an internet programmer. This tool enables you to track code improvements and be sure you adhere to coding greatest methods. It additionally aids you collaborate with various other creators, allowing you to full tasks a lot faster and also even more properly.
The 1st action in getting begun along with GitHub is actually to set up Git, which is actually readily available for each Mac and also Windows. You can download and install the system for free of cost from GitHub’s site.
There are lots of different coding languages that internet designers use, relying on their specialized. It’s component of every web page on the internet and can be an effective resource in any type of web professional’s collection.